Sensing Systems and Methods with Phase Unwrapping Based on a Dynamic Phase Change Model

摘要

A system includes distributed sensors and a receiver that receives signals from the distributed sensors and that produces one or more interferometry signals from the received signals. The system also includes a digitizer to digitize each of the one or more interferometry signals. The system also includes at least one processing unit that processes each digitized interferometry signal to obtain unwrapped phase information and related parameter values. The unwrapped phase information is obtained based on a comparison of a current phase measurement with a reference phase predicted using a dynamic phase change model.
